Structure Restoration Services

At Swartz Restoration, we partner with many of the local fire departments so that we are one of the first faces you meet after you have experienced this emergency.

  1. The first step in structure restoration is the Board Up.
    The Board Up is all about securing your property from further damage.
    We seal up broken windows and doors so that thieves and critters do not enter your property and cause more damage than has already occurred.
  2. The next step is the initial assessment.
    We walk through your property, examining the source of the damage and the extent of the damage.
    We are looking for anything that requires immediate attention, as we begin formulating the plan of action for restoration.
  3. The next step is crafting an estimate for the scope of repairs.
    We use the same software that the leading insurance companies use, which provides a thorough explanation of detail of the restoration process.
    It makes communicating with your insurance company that much easier and smoother!
  4. The next step is the contract signing.
    We meet with you to go through the thorough estimate, explaining each aspect and answering all of your questions.
    Our commitment to you is a complete, thorough and smooth restoration process.
  5. The next step is material ordering.
    Once you sign the contract, we begin conversations about what color paint you want, and what type of flooring, and which fixtures you want installed.
    Your property gets to become custom restored, involving you in the process as much as possible.
  6. The last step is the actual physical restoration work.
    The damaged materials are removed, and the new materials are built and installed, getting you that much closer to a fully restored home or business.
